Buffalo Linkstation Duo Mini nas LS-WSGL/R1 with 2 x 320GB drives.

This is a small form-factor NAS device with two 320GB 2.5" drives, which 
can be mirrored.

Supports CIFS and AppleTalk.  Last firmware date is 2008.  I used CIFS and 
SFTP from my Macs, so I don't know if the AppleTalk works with the later 
MacOS X versions.

I didn't try to use Time Machine with it - so I have no idea if that would 
be successful.

I replaced it with an 8TB NAS.

LinkStation Mini™ - LS-WSGL/R1
Ultra Compact. Ultra Quiet. Ultra Reliable.
Buffalo's LinkStation Mini™ is an ultra compact, fan-less, network 
attached, dual-drive data storage device. Its palm sized form factor and 
very quiet operation make this NAS unit an ideal addition to your 
entertainment center. Its low power consumption is attractive for those 
leaving the unit powered on 24/7.

The built-in Web Access feature lets you access your files anytime via a 
Web browser from anywhere! A built-in DLNA CERTIFIED™ media server makes 
streaming audio and visual content to any DLNA player or PC a snap.

Business class features like Active Directory support make this portable 
NAS a good solution for IT personnel that has to serve remote offi ce 
locations.



• Ultra compact using 2.5" hard drives
• Fan-less. ultra-quiet operation
• Share and access your files over the Internet without additional software 
using Web Access
• Active Directory support*
• Supports RAID 1 Mirroring and RAID 0 Striping 
• Use any Windows or Macintosh computer
• Easy Setup does not require drivers
• Supports UPS connectivity
• Minimal power consumption
